2nd XC trip

Sunday, June 27th, 2010

To celebrate my 2nd XC (Cross Country) trip I have made a new para movie, based on video footage taken before the trip. Check is out before you read:

There was no blue sky on the way to Birstonas. After an hour of driving our wings were ready for cloudy sky. Few pilots were in their trip already. Few of them were on the way back by ground taxi.

A car with the active lift system (automatically adjustable pull system based on rolling out wire) is key to lift. White small car was on the way. A college of mine lifted first. No sun, no thermal activity and after 15minutes you need to think about landing. 2nd try for me and for my college was the same as 1st. Enjoyable lift to ~800m and a fight with the wind.
3rd try was more successful.

He got lifted for few minutes by rain clouds. A huge highway of rainy clouds were passing through our starting field. 3rd try for me was a beginning of my 2nd cross country trip! Lifted to 800m and based on commands from the ground faced my wing to the highway! No way back because of strong wind…
After few minutes I reached the big dark cloud and got zero of climb. Then about 0.8m/s lift was my saver whole journey.

Like a bird. Passing woods and rivers. Catching air and flying to unknown. Breathing cold air, touching clouds with your hand. Unthinkable!!!
After about 25minutes my lift was over and I started to climb very quickly. After about 10minutes of fight I gave up. Landing target was spotted.

Called my college to pick me up. In total my trip was about 20 kilometers. Which is not bad that day ant time for a beginner.

Friday: ground handling in Vilnius center

Sunday, May 2nd, 2010

It wasn’t a usual Friday evening this week.. In the middle of PM scrum I’ve got a sms from my wife with an invitation for a date :) The offer was accepted, and mad Gadas is on his way with the wing in a car trunk:

The wind was perfect for ground handling, and especially for ground handling without harness. Never tried that before and was a little bit afraid to humiliate myself in front of all that crowd in Vilnius center. The begining, as expected, wasn’t so successful, probably because of incorrect handling, but after some advices from Jurijus Jakovlevas (who was busy with the arcus stutends that day) things became more stable ;)
At the end of the day the wing gave up and started to listen to me even without harness, just with risers in the right hand, and brakes in the left. Lots and lost of joy playing with the wing in that way. As Jurijus said: “There’s no real practical benefit playing with the wing without harness.. just a pure play with the wing.”
